The Book Collector's Handbook by Anne Johnson is a comprehensive guide aimed at both novice and experienced book collectors. It offers practical advice on building, organizing, and preserving a personal collection, along with insights into identifying valuable editions, understanding book conditions, and managing collection growth. The book emphasizes historical context, collectible categories, and tips for appraising and maintaining the value of books over time.
